As some of you may know, we are mourning the passing of a beloved  member of our family,  Amril "Rudy" Radford. Loving husband to Joan, father and father-in-law of Dianna & Jim, grandfather of Fielding  and great-grandfather to his name-sake Amril James. We are are very proud that he will among the first  veterans to be interred at the new Eastern Washington State Veterans Cemetery in Medical Lake. This long-awaited veterans cemetery was appropriately dedicated this Memorial Day and interments will begin on June 7th. We are blessed that he will have the opportunity to be honored by his country for his service at his burial on June 10th, 2010 at 1 pm.
Thank you so much for your condolences and prayers; they mean so much. We miss our "Poppy" dearly.
